We were aware of the issues as soon as we saw the shower. The grout lines were badly deteriorated and in poor condition. They had accumulated dirt, filth, and soap residue, giving them a murky, opaque appearance. The caulking in the joints had also been damaged. We noticed the grout had to be sealed as well. Grout is porous, allowing it to absorb a wide range of substances. It's critical to use a special sealant to avoid structural damage.

A few days following the evaluation, we went back to our client's home with our professional equipment to begin the restoration. To carry out a successful restoration, a sequence of steps must be taken. We started by using a high-speed scrubber and our own product to clean the surface. Our pH-neutral, soap-free cleaner won't harm your tiles or grout because it doesn't leave a residue. After thoroughly cleaning the floor, we steam cleaned the area to eliminate entrenched dirt.

To finish this procedure, we utilized a more lasting epoxy solution instead of caulk and applied it to all vertical and horizontal joints. Our product is not porous like regular caulk or grout, and it has a range of benefits. It is ideal for showers since it minimizes mold and mildew growth. For the final part of the restoration, we continued the sealing procedure.

ColorSeal by Sir Grout was used to provide the best protection. Our high-quality sealer protects against dirt, filth, and other external contaminants. It helps to prevent wear and tear from everyday use while also making cleaning simple and quick. ColorSeal improves the appearance of the surface by enhancing the grout. It comes in a range of colors, allowing the owner to match the tiles with the grout. When we were finished, the shower's surface had been restored and looked gorgeous.

Before leaving, our specialists gave the homeowner some tips on how to keep the tiles and grout in good condition, like sweeping the floor on a regular basis to remove loose dirt and dust. After that, we recommended using pH-neutral, soap-free floor cleaners like Sir Grout's Natural Hard Surface Cleaner to clean the tile and grout. Just let it soak for 5 minutes before mopping the surface. Keep the surface dry with a towel or cloth to remove any liquid or cleaner residue that sinks into the grout lines.

Mold and mildew can be dangerous to everyone at home, putting everyone's health at risk. Make sure the shower is well-ventilated and dry to avoid this issue. You can provide a source of fresh air by leaving a door ajar or a window open. After you've completed showering, dry the surface with a squeegee, a towel, or a terry cloth rag. Squeegeeing on a regular basis also contributes to the removal of filth and stains.
